ESU of Inductance

ESU

Definition

Electrostatic Unit of inductance in the CGS system, approximately 8.99 × 10^11 henries.

History/Origin

Part of the CGS electrostatic unit system, used in theoretical physics and electrostatic theory.

Current Use

Used in theoretical physics, electrostatic theory, and CGS system calculations.

Microhenry

µH

Definition

A unit of inductance equal to 10^-6 henries, very commonly used in electronics.

History/Origin

Part of the SI prefix system, with "micro" meaning 10^-6, extensively used in electronics.

Current Use

Extensively used in electronics, RF circuits, power supplies, and electrical circuits.
